Low Testosterone and Its Impact on Erectile Dysfunction
Low testosterone, or Low-T, is a condition characterized by a decrease in the production of the hormone testosterone. Testosterone plays a crucial role in men’s sexual health, influencing various functions such as libido, erectile function, and the production of sperm. When testosterone levels drop below the normal range, it can lead to a range of symptoms, including reduced sexual desire, fatigue, depression, and erectile dysfunction.
The impact of low testosterone on erectile function is particularly significant. Testosterone contributes to the stimulation of nitric oxide production, a key factor in achieving and maintaining an erection. Therefore, a deficiency in testosterone levels can lead to difficulties in achieving and sustaining erections, resulting in erectile dysfunction. This interconnection between Low-T and ED underscores the importance of addressing low testosterone as a fundamental component of treating erectile dysfunction.

Exploring Extracorporeal Shock Wave Therapy (ESWT) as a Treatment Option
As men seek effective and non-invasive treatments for erectile dysfunction linked to low testosterone, one promising option to consider is Extracorporeal Shock Wave Therapy (ESWT). ESWT is a non-surgical, non-invasive treatment that has demonstrated efficacy in improving erectile function by promoting the growth of new blood vessels and stimulating the release of growth factors in the penile tissues.
Through targeted shock waves, ESWT stimulates angiogenesis, the process of forming new blood vessels, which can enhance blood flow to the penis and improve erectile function. Additionally, ESWT has been shown to have beneficial effects on the regeneration of nerve fibers in the penile tissues, contributing to improved sensation and erectile response. The Connection Between Low Testosterone and Erectile Dysfunction
Research indicates a clear correlation between Low Testosterone and Erectile Dysfunction. Low levels of testosterone can contribute to a reduced sex drive and impair the ability to achieve and maintain erections. Testosterone is essential for the proper functioning of the blood vessels and erectile tissue in the penis, and a deficiency can lead to vascular and structural changes that affect erectile function.
Studies have shown that men with Low Testosterone are more likely to experience Erectile Dysfunction. Furthermore, the presence of comorbidities such as diabetes, obesity, and hypertension, which are often associated with Low Testosterone, can further exacerbate the risk of developing Erectile Dysfunction. The Potential Link Between Low-T and Erectile Dysfunction
Erectile dysfunction (ED) is the inability to achieve or maintain an erection sufficient for sexual intercourse. While it can occur for various reasons, including psychological and lifestyle factors, low testosterone levels can also contribute to the development of ED. Testosterone plays a pivotal role in stimulating the penile tissues to produce nitric oxide, a molecule that helps initiate and maintain an erection.
When testosterone levels are low, the body may struggle to produce adequate nitric oxide, leading to difficulties with achieving and maintaining erections. Additionally, decreased libido and overall sexual satisfaction can also be associated with low testosterone levels.
